Block 1,008,389
Block Hash
f75f468e8e937b41b399d8764ff3ff39a76dd2e3a2b4ecee42c208c67d
da4388
Previous Block Hash
636fd89697c710fef7bb1734c8582798a45ede21039cab0195cdbacfda 15e8c1
Mined
Transactions
2
Difficulty
24.50 M
Size
396 bytes
Transactions (2)
1 input, 1 output
10,000.014465
PEPE
1 input, 2 outputs
209.71441131
PEPE